
On this episode, Megan and Ely, are joined by community partner Marisa, a Health Promotion Specialist from Texas State University, and discuss the need for skills around healthy breakups and what that looks like for all kinds of relationships. They explore helpful and unhelpful tips for breaking up in friendships, family relationships, romantic/sexual relationships, and unhealthy/abusive dynamics. Since relationships are a part of all of our lives, join us in getting more intentional about how we can have healthy relationships even when we’re ending them.
